Poet in the Wilderness Rachel Freeman
Poet in the Wilderness
Rachel Freeman
Recent years have brought about a crisis of faith for many who have grown up Evangelical.
Rachel Freeman is one of those individuals.
Striking out into the wilderness of liminal space has been disorienting, but she has used poetry as a deconstruction and regrowth tool. Through the writings in this book she has worked to exhume the truth buried in the Bible, to clear away the dirt heaped upon us, to sort through what relics do not hold value, and to polish the gems she discovered along the way.
